Naval General Service 1915-62, 1 clasp, Malaya, G.VI.R. (R.M.9360 R. N. Hollas. Mne. R.M.) mounted as worn on original riband with top wearing pin, in card box of issue, extremely fine £120-£160 --- Robert Nicol Hollas was born at Calderhead, Lanarkshire, on 18 August 1931, and attested for the Royal Marines at Glasgow on 27 June 1949, his papers stating ‘under age’. Sent to Royal Marine Commando School 15 August 1950, he was appointed Marine 1st Class on 24 February 1951 and joined 41 Commando at Tamar on 24 October 1951. Transferred to 45 Commando, he served at Eastney and Plymouth and was later awarded his Naval General Service Medal for Malaya on 21 July 1956. Enrolled in the Royal Fleet Reserve from 18 August 1956 to 17 August 1961 to complete engagement, he passed his exams as Leading Seaman on 28 November 1963, further qualifying in the maintenance and repair of inflatable life saving equipment at the Safety Equipment and Survival Training School, Hillhead. Discharged from H.M.S. Cochrane on 4 October 1965, he died in Motherwell on 30 September 2017, aged 86. Sold with a comprehensive archive of original documentation including Certificate of Service in the Royal Marines; Certificate of Service in the Royal Navy (R.F.R.); Trade Certificate (Seaman Branch), with reference; Trade Certificate named to recipient stating 6 years, 6 months service in Underwater Control, Seaman Branch (Torpedo Anti-Submarine Warfare); Record of T.A.S. Service as ASDIC Operator; R.N. Education Test Certificate for Leading Rate; H.M.S. Tiger Association Membership Card to ‘Robert & Heather Hollis’; family letters and snapshots; Collins Royal & Merchant Naval Diary, detailing early postings; and a H.M.S. Tiger wooden plaque.
